& Summary Business Unit Overview This is an exciting opportunity to work within the Government and Public Sector Business Unit and its Transformation Management Consulting team, where you will play a key role in developing and delivering strategy based projects, to clients in the Government and Public Sector in the Middle East. We focus on helping solve client problems by offering both strategic and operational expertise. We pride ourselves on building long-lasting relationships with companies and organizations, always ensuring that we are able to bring the best insights and solutions to help them tackle whatever critical issues they may face. You will be exposed to the PwC proprietary methodologies and tools built from experiences of numerous prior engagements and leading practices, to enable you to efficiently and effectively deliver to our clients in a timely and reliable manner.SummaryA career within People and Organization services, will provide you with the opportunity to help our clients reset their talent strategies and deliver extraordinary business results through their people. We focus on evaluating and managing their unique challenges so our clients can maximize their return on the overall investment in human capital. You'll gain a tremendous depth of expertise in all aspects of human capital, including creating sustainable value through people culture and change, designing compensation and retirement strategies, and improving human capital operations.Responsibilities: As a Director, you'll work as part of a team of problem solvers with extensive consulting and industry experience, helping our clients solve their complex business issues from strategy to execution. Specific responsibilities include but are not limited to: Proactively lead the practice by setting strategy, drive the development of new business in the market, and provide technical advice across disciplinesBuilding strong networks within the firm to spot and capitalize on opportunities to get involved in projects that others are leading across a number of different business units and sectorsIdentifying and discussing key issues with our clients to identify potential opportunitiesResponsibility for a majority of day-to-day client communicationsResponsibility to shape and deliver various projects that exceed the expectations of our clients and our own assignment quality criteriaManage and deliver large projects by developing the project team, assessing engagement risks throughout, driving conclusions, and reviewing / challenging the output produced by the teamResponsibility for management of engagement financialsHelping to grow and develop our team through hands on training and coachingPreferred skills: Bilingual in English and Arabic essential.Previous experience in advising clients within Transportation, Real Estate and Energy sectors.In-depth knowledge of Organisation Design and Change Management.Rewards, or Corporate Performance and Effectiveness.Achievement oriented with the ability to be flexible and adaptive on a daily basis. Able to lead a high-performing team and add exceptional value to our clients within a fast-paced environment.Ability to simultaneously manage multiple tasks and engagement, and possibly different project teams.Qualifications & Requirements: Bachelor's degree or equivalent in a relevant subject such as Engineering, Business Administration, Human Resources or Psychology. An MBA or an MA in Human CapitalManagement from a reputable university is preferred.CIPD, GPHR, SHRM or equivalent are preferable and beneficial for the candidate to perform the role.Substantial experience of establishing and building strong client relationships across multiple industries and geographies.Strong interest and passion for developing, growing and leading a team through advanced coaching and mentoring, as well as proactive knowledge sharing.Excellent organisational skills, having the ability to prioritise work load whilst being resilient and being able to cope well under pressure and meeting tight deadlines.Proven IT skills in the following programmes excel, word, and PowerPoint.The ability and willingness to travel within the Middle East and worldwide where the project requirement dictate.A minimum of 10 years of relevant experience in human capital leadership, of which a least 5 years will have been in a consulting environment.Education (if blank, degree and/or field of study not specified)Degrees/Field of Study required:Degrees/Field of Study preferred:Certifications (if blank, certifications not specified) Required Skills Optional Skills Desired Languages (If blank, desired languages not specified) Travel RequirementsUp to 60%Available for Work Visa SponsorshipYesGovernment Clearance RequiredNo
